Title :
An architecture for integrated system management of UNIX systems

Abstract :
This paper presents the concepts and design methods of an architecture for the management of interconnected UNIX systems. The basic parts of this architecture are a manager which is designed as an object-oriented database application, several functionally extended agents and an object-oriented, dynamically generatable user interface
